About Me

My name is Samuel Afriyie. A young man of age 29.
I completed Junior High School at Adenta Community School in Accra.
Being a young Man and very enthusiastic about Education, yet I had a big challenge
when I completed Senior High Technical School at Koforidua Secondary Technical
School in the Eastern Region of Ghana.
Dark in Completion, about 5.4 feet tall. Haven Completed H.N.D Electrical Engineering, it is My wish to pursue Degree as well as Masters in My
Field of Endeavor.

My Business

I am employed at Mast Project Infrastructure Ltd as a Field Maintenance Technician Engineer.
I have enjoyed working with team of Engineers.
By Me working as a Electrician and Repairing electrical gadgets, troubleshooting and repairing Computers basic faults.
I also do buying and selling of slightly used gadgets.

Loan Proposal

I plan to invest some amount of the loan whiles the rest will be used
to expand My buying and selling of slightly used gadgets .
My investment will be made with respect to the future amount I am
expecting from My business. I hope the business will yield enough
profit gains and help Me have hope in My education to be furthered.
I also plan to help others in establishing good business and
be able to care for themselves and their Families.
